Learn how mastering requirements gathering through an Executive Development Programme can drive business success, reduce risk, and ensure stakeholder alignment.
In the dynamic world of business, the ability to gather and document requirements effectively is akin to having a compass in uncharted waters. It guides projects, ensures stakeholder alignment, and ultimately drives success. This is where an Executive Development Programme focused on Requirements Gathering and Documentation Essentials comes into play. Let's dive into the practical applications and real-world case studies that make this programme a game-changer for executives.
Introduction to Requirements Gathering: The Foundation of Success
Requirements gathering is more than just collecting information; it's about understanding the essence of what stakeholders need and translating that into actionable plans. For executives, this skill is invaluable. It ensures that projects are aligned with business goals, reduces the risk of scope creep, and enhances overall project efficiency.
Practical Insights: The Art of Effective Communication
Effective communication is the cornerstone of successful requirements gathering. Executives often interact with diverse teams and stakeholders, each with their unique perspectives and priorities. Here are some practical insights:
1. Active Listening: Engage with stakeholders by actively listening to their needs. Ask open-ended questions to encourage detailed responses. For instance, instead of asking, "Do you want feature X?", ask, "What challenges are you facing with the current system?"
2. Clarifying Ambiguities: Ambiguity can derail a project. Use techniques like the "Five Whys" to delve deeper into the root cause of requirements. For example, if a stakeholder asks for a faster system, probe further to understand what "faster" means in their context.
3. Documenting Clearly: Clear documentation is crucial. Use templates that are easy to follow and update regularly. Tools like Confluence or SharePoint can help maintain transparency and ensure everyone is on the same page.
Real-World Case Study: Transforming a Retail Giant
Consider the case of RetailCorp, a multinational retail chain. The company was struggling with inefficient inventory management, leading to stockouts and overstocking. The executive team decided to implement an Executive Development Programme in Requirements Gathering to address these issues.
Step 1: Stakeholder Identification
The first step was identifying key stakeholders, including store managers, warehouse supervisors, and IT personnel. Each had unique insights and challenges.
Step 2: Requirements Elicitation
Workshops and one-on-one interviews were conducted to gather requirements. Store managers emphasized the need for real-time inventory updates, while warehouse supervisors highlighted the importance of automated restocking alerts. IT personnel focused on system integration and scalability.
Step 3: Documentation and Validation
The gathered requirements were documented using a structured template. Each requirement was validated through feedback sessions with stakeholders, ensuring clarity and alignment. Tools like JIRA were used to track progress and manage changes.
Step 4: Implementation and Monitoring
The new inventory management system was implemented, and continuous monitoring ensured that it met the documented requirements. Regular check-ins with stakeholders helped address any emerging issues promptly.
The result? A significant reduction in stockouts and overstocking, leading to improved customer satisfaction and operational efficiency. RetailCorp's success story is a testament to the power of effective requirements gathering.
The Role of Technology in Requirements Gathering
Technology plays a pivotal role in enhancing the requirements gathering process. Tools like JIRA, Confluence, and Trello can streamline documentation and collaboration. Here are some practical applications:
1. User Stories and Epics: Use tools like JIRA to create user stories and epics that capture requirements in a user-centric manner. This helps in visualizing the end-user experience and ensures that the solution meets real-world needs.
2. Collaboration Platforms: Platforms like Confluence can host detailed documentation, allowing stakeholders to contribute and review in real